Your server has unexpectedly terminated the connection. Possible causes for
this include server problems, network problems, or a long period of inactivity. Subject 'Fw: Confession interactive', Account: 'POP3', Server: 'SMTP1.nb.sympatico.ca', Protocol: SMTP, Server Response: '421 Exceeded allowable connection time, disconnecting.', Port: 25, Secure(SSL): No, Server Error: 421, Error Number: 0x800CCC0F -- Deny2221 |

Deny2221 wrote:
Your server has unexpectedly terminated the connection. Possible causes for this include server problems, network problems, or a long period of inactivity. Subject 'Fw: Confession interactive', Account: 'POP3', Server: 'SMTP1.nb.sympatico.ca', Protocol: SMTP, Server Response: '421 Exceeded allowable connection time, disconnecting.', Port: 25, Secure(SSL): No, Server Error: 421, Error Number: 0x800CCC0F I'm sorry to hear that. You forgot to tell us: 1. How large is "large". (Most ISPs cap the size of emails/attachments.) 2. What mail client you are using. 3. Anything about your computer. 4. The answer to The First Question of Troubleshooting: Assuming this process once worked, what changed between the time things worked and the time they didn't? 5. What you have already done to troubleshoot. 6. How you connect to the Internet (method). Malke -- MS-MVP Elephant Boy Computers www.elephantboycomputers.com Don't Panic! |
